From the makers of Making Obama, WBEZ Chicago presents Making Beyoncé, a new three-part bio-podcast series that explores Beyoncé Knowles’ rise from local talent shows to global musical icon.
Making Beyoncé is hosted by Jill Hopkins and produced by Joe DeCeault.

In 1993, Beyoncé Knowles and the members of Girls Tyme competed in the popular TV talent competition Star Search, hoping to find stardom.
After Girls Tyme dissolves, Beyoncé and the other girls begin building their new group, Destiny’s Child. Finally, things start to click.
Beyoncé breaks out on her own, but the path to stardom isn’t an easy one.
